I was browsing the Texas Department of Criminal Justice (TDCJ) page, and I noticed in their visitor policies that visitors today must fill out a form. Perhaps this was not so back in 1980, but let's be real, 1980 wasn't THAT long ago. Additionally, given this was a maximum facility prison housing death row inmates, I'd be surprised if visitors didn't have to get pre-authorization. At the very least, she needed to schedule a time AND produce identification upon arrival...which means she absolutely had to have legal identification.

It's a long shot (and will definitely come with a wait, if it comes at all), but filing a public information request per Texas Code Section 552.201(a) for "any and all visitor logs and visitor requests for November 1, 1980 and November 2, 1980" might be worth a try...

http://www.tdcj.state.tx.us/documents/policy/ED1512.pdf
 
Allow me to correct myself:

IF WCJD was under 18, she MAY NOT have had to produce identification per the current TDCJ policies. Accepted forms of identification for minors include school ID cards.
